#开始配置
stream {

upstream cloudsocket {
hash $remote_addr consistent;
zone myapp1 64k;
server 172.XX.XX.XX:3306 weight=600 max_fails=13 fail_timeout=600s; #需要代理的地址
}
server { #本机监听的地址的端口
listen 6666;#数据库服务器监听端口
proxy_connect_timeout 300000s;
proxy_timeout 300000s;#设置客户端和代理服务之间的超时时间,如果5分钟内没操作将自动断开。
proxy_pass cloudsocket;
}

#多数据库映射
upstream mssqlsocket {
hash $remote_addr consistent;
zone myapp1 64k;
server 182.XX.XX.XX:6666 weight=600 max_fails=13 fail_timeout=600s;
}
server {
listen 8888;#数据库服务器监听端口
proxy_connect_timeout 10000s;
proxy_timeout 300000s;#设置客户端和代理服务之间的超时时间,如果5分钟内没操作将自动断开。
proxy_pass mssqlsocket;
}
}

#直接复制根据自己实际需要代理的IP修改即可

nginx代理数据库相关推荐

  1. nginx代理内网1521,3306数据库端口

    nginx代理内网oralce数据库地址 客户申请了两台云服务器,一个公网ip:一应用一数据: 上线后导致运维困难,无法便捷查看生产数据库. 因此使用nginx代理数据库地址 新增steam模块 yu ...

  2. nginx代理MySQL实现数据库远程办公

    1.先查看nginx当前版本编译时的参数 # /usr/local/nginx/sbin/nginx -V nginx version: nginx/1.10.3 built by gcc 4.4.7 ...

  3. nginx 反向代理数据库端口

    nginx 反向代理数据库端口 使用场景如下: 当数据库在服务器A 并且处于外网无法直接访问时,此时同局域网下只有服务器B提供对外访问,客户能访问b 却无法访问A 的情况下,由于两台服务器处于同局域网 ...

  4. nginx代理mysql数据库 stream

    写作背景 在某云搞了个服务器,装了个数据库后一切配置OK,发现远程连接不上,排查了一天没有找到问题(安全组策略及防火墙.开放端口) .在毫无头绪之际突然想到nginx代理的80端口可以访问,本着All ...

  5. 【Nginx学习】Nginx代理mysql数据库

    文章目录 一.使用docker安装Nginx 1.安装Nginx 2 .启动容器 二.命令查看端口 1.查看Liunx端口占用 2.命令nmap端口扫描 3.docker容器的本机ip地址 三.doc ...

  6. Nginx.代理MySQL

    Nginx.代理MySQL 1. Nginx在安装的时候,需要加上一个参数:--with-stream 即Nginx安装指令为:./configure --prefix=/u01/app/nginx  ...

  7. 若依前后端分离版本,Windows下使用Nginx代理的方式进行部署(全流程,图文教程)

    场景 若依官网: http://doc.ruoyi.vip/ 前提: 服务器上安装Mysql,并将数据库导入,在SpringBoot中的application-druid.yml配置mysql数据库连 ...

  8. 西安阿里云代理商:vue项目部署到阿里云服务器(windows)Nginx代理

    西安阿里云代理商:聚搜云 是上海聚搜信息技术有限公司旗下品牌,坐落于魔都上海,服务于全球.2019年成为阿里云代理商生态合作伙伴.与阿里云代理商.腾讯云.西部数码.美橙互联.聚搜云,长期战略合作的计划 ...

  9. Nginx代理mysql端口

    Nginx代理mysql端口 1.安装1.9以上版本nginx并配置stream模块 cd /usr/local/wget 'http://nginx.org/download/nginx-1.9.9 ...

最新文章

  1. 招聘|腾讯机器人实验室语义视觉方向(实习+社招)
  2. inotify介绍及rsync + inotify 实时同步备份
  3. 线程池之ScheduledThreadPoolExecutor线程池源码分析笔记
  4. P1983 车站分级
  5. spring容器实例化bean的3种方式
  6. jaxb xsd生成xml_使用JAXB和Jackson从XSD生成JSON模式
  7. 信息学奥赛一本通 2054:【例3.4】适合晨练
  8. 用gcc/g++编译运行C/C++程序
  9. FluentValidation:一个非常受欢迎的,用于构建强类型验证规则的.NET 库
  10. 千万千万不要运行的Linux命令
  11. 诺基亚n1支持java功能_关于诺基亚N1你必须要了解这10个问题!
  12. linux教程 课件ppt,Linux操作系统实用教程全集 教学课件 中文PPT版
  13. SPSS 安装后不可用 没有出现授权 不显示工具栏 桌面没有快捷图标
  14. 翟菜花:国产游戏为什么还不适合出海“亮剑”
  15. 时间戳转时间精确到毫秒
  16. Python一个回合制兵棋小游戏(1)
  17. Android音乐播放器-热门榜单
  18. dss nginx 403 forbidden
  19. 在springboot整合mybatis遇到的数据库连接不上问题解决
  20. 20、JAVA进阶——集合(1)

热门文章

  1. gazebo 仿真 kinect 获取点云数据
  2. NFT市场平台必须具备的优势和特点
  3. Java单元测试实践-21.使用Gradle执行单元测试
  4. MATLAB算法实战应用案例精讲-【智能优化算法】多目标布谷鸟搜索算法(MOCS) (附MATLAB代码实现)
  5. java如何实现多个小球碰撞后反弹以及绘制动态图。
  6. BMI指数(Body Mass Index)
  7. CPU转接卡引起的故障维修
  8. esp32 控制ws2812灯带
  9. IS-95A CDMA移动通信基站子系统(转)
  10. 阿里云天池大赛——机器学习篇赛题解析(赛题一)思维导图